A 'hired gun' for new management

Article Abstract:

Carlton S Chen, the vice pres and general counsel of firearms maker Colt's Manufacturing Co, Inc, supervises patent and trademark administration and does most of the company's contract work as the sole in-house lawyer. The legal budget was $2.2 mil in 1996 but down about 30% the next year. Colt attempted a takeover of Belgian gunmaker F.N. Herstal SA in July 1997 when it was in financial trouble. but the Belgian government rejected the plan.

Quality is the key, not cost control

Article Abstract:

Edward V. Lahey, Jr., the senior vice pres, general counsel and secretary of Pepsico, supervises a department of 80 in-house lawyers and has an outside legal budget of $25 mil. The in-house lawyers practice mainly securities and trademark law, financings and acquisitions. Litigation is done mainly by outside counsel. Lahey states his department has long been cost-conscious and considers his in-house purpose to be preventive.

Banking on lawyers to play by the rules

Article Abstract:

Michael E. Bleier is the General Counsel to Mellon Bank Corp. This profile of him includes descriptions of the legal department he leads at Mellon Bank as well information about his legal career and his personal life. Bleier comments specifically on the relationship between in-house and outside counsel, and generally on changing dynamics in the legal profession.
